Egg packaging
[re6stnet.git] / docs / re6st-conf
1 OPTIONS : RE6ST-SETUP
2     usage : ./setup [options...]
3     --server address
4              Ip address of the machine running the re6stnet server. Both ipv4
5              and ipv6 addresses are supported.
6
7     --port port
8              Port to connect to on the machine running the re6stnet server.
9
10     -d, --dir directory
11             Path of a directory where will be stored the files generated by the
12             setup. The Setup genereates the following files, in the explicit
13             order :
14             - ca.pem : certificate authority file downloaded from the server
15             - peers.db : peers database initialized for re6stnet.py
16             - cert.key : private key generated by the script
17             - cert.crt : individual certificate file generated by the server
18             - dh2048.pem : dh file for oenvpn server
19
20     -r, --req name value
21             Specify an attribute to add to the certificate request sent to the
22             server. Can be used multiple times.
23             Each use of the --req name value, will add the attribute name with
24             the associated value in the sugbject of the certificate request.
25
26     --ca-only
27             Stop the script after downloading the certificate authority file
28             from the server
29
30     --db-only
31             Stop the script after creating the peers DB and downloading the
32             connection information of a bootstrap node of the VPN.
33
34     --no-boot
35             Does not re'quest a bootstrap peer to the peer discovery server
36             (useful in debug when the server does not have any peer in his
37             database). When requesting a bootstrap peer to a server whoch does
38             not have any, an execption will occur, and the script will stop
39